FOOTBALL.

As a good deal of argument; lias been indulged in over the new rules of scoring in the game of iiugby Football, we quote rule 7,' which raus as follows: A match shall be' decided by a majority of points; a goal shall equal three poiuts, with the exception of a goal kicked from a kick awarded 'by way- of penalty, which shall equal t wo points, and a try. one point, If the number of points be equal, or no goal be kicked or try obtained, the,match shall be drawn. When a goal is kicked from a try the goal only is scored. 1 ' The above is taken from a copy of the rules of the English Rugby Union just received by Mr S. H. Wickerson from Rowland Hill, the great English, authority on the game/ VVe'aro repriuting these rules, so the clubs and players may obtain copies and put themselves right on any point in which they are in doubt.
